Market Cap
Market cap is the total market value of all of a company's outstanding shares.
ROE
Return on equity (ROE) is a measure of financial performance, calculated by dividing net income by shareholders' equity.
P/E Ratio(TTM)
P/E (price-to-earnings) ratio is the ratio of a company's share price to its earnings per share (EPS). P/E ratio is used to determine whether a company is overvalued or undervalued.
Book Value
The amount of money that a company's shareholders would earn if it is liquidated and has paid off all liabilities.
P/B Ratio
P/B (price-to-book) ratio is the ratio of a company's share price to its book value. Any value under 1.0 is considered a good P/B value.
Dividend Yield
Dividend yield percentage is the amount of money a company pays its shareholders for owning a share of its stock divided by its current stock price.
Industry P/E
The average P/E ratio of all the stocks in any sector. Different sectors consider different P/E ratios as healthy.
EPS(TTM)
Earnings per share (EPS) is a company's net profit divided by the number of its common outstanding shares. It indicates how much money a company makes for each share of its stock.
Face Value
The original value of a company's stock as written in its books of accounts and its share certificates. Also known as par value, it is fixed when the stock is first issued.
Debt to Equity
Debt to Equity is the percentage of the total liabilities of a company (debt) to its shareholders' equity. A higher debt to equity means the company is using more debt funds than equity funds, and a lower debt to equity means more equity than debt funds.

OCL Iron and Steel Limited is an India-based company primarily engaged in the production of steel billets and sponge iron with plants located in iron ore and coal-rich. The Company’s segments include Steel, Power and Auto. Its products and process include steel billets, direct reduced iron (DRI) and power. It has a design range of approximately 80 square millimeters to 200 square millimeters. The Company exports approximately six megawatts (MW) of power to the grid. Its power is generated from the waste heat recovery boiler (WHRB) from the DRI process. The Company also has an over 14 MW captive power plant that supports all the energy requirements. It has mines or iron ore at Kundaposi near Barbil and Coal at Radihkapur near Talcher. The Company has production units at Rajgangpur, District Sundergarh, Orissa.;
